> Jeremy Fitzhardinge wrote:
> > Add the "nosegneg" fake capabilty to the vsyscall page notes. This is
> > used by the runtime linker to select a glibc version which then
> > disables negative-offset accesses to the thread-local segment via
> > %gs. These accesses require emulation in Xen (because segments are
> > truncated to protect the hypervisor address space) and avoiding them
> > provides a measurable performance boost.
> >   
> 
> I don't like this because now a kernel compiled with both CONFIG_XEN and 
> CONFIG_VMI has "nosegneg" turned on.  We don't actually require this for 
> performance or correctness, so it would be nice to be able to 
> dynamically turn it off instead of having it forced.
